    Novak Djokovic Battles Through US Open Opener

    At age 38, Novak Djokovic stepped onto Arthur Ashe Stadium with a mission: chase a record-extending 25th Grand Slam singles title. The American crowd, excited for Learner Tien, saw Djokovic dig deep—overcoming an injury scare and early set struggles—to win 6-1, 7-6(3), 6-2.

    Djokovic needed all his experience. He appeared troubled by a bloodied toe, hip discomfort, and even endured an awkward fall that drew gasps from the crowd and concern from his team. Yet, the Serbian icon remained in control, taking the tiebreak in the second set and powering through the third.

    After the win, Novak Djokovic reflected, “The first set went fast, but the second was a battle. I had to fight for every point. I’m not at my best, but glad to begin the tournament this way”.

    A Champion’s Shifting Approach for Longevity

    Entering the US Open, Novak Djokovic surprised many by skipping recent tournaments in Canada and Cincinnati. Instead, he chose to focus on recovery, time with family, and careful practice—a move more US athletes now embrace. “At this stage of my career, I’ve earned the right to choose my schedule. Quality over quantity is key,” Djokovic explained in a pre-tournament press conference.

    US commentators debate: Will this new approach help Djokovic extend his prime, or does it risk exposing him to the sharpness and stamina of younger rivals like Jannik Sinner or Carlos Alcaraz?

    Novak Djokovic’s Grand Slam Resume: Stats that Stun

    Djokovic’s greatness is written in the numbers. He now owns 24 Grand Slam singles titles—just one away from an unprecedented 25. He is the only player in the Open Era with 75 straight first-round wins at Grand Slam events, 55 in straight sets.

    Since 2021, Djokovic’s Grand Slam finals streak has included the 2021 Australian Open, 2021 French Open, and a US Open triumph in 2023. His last Slam win was the 2023 US Open, while he made the Wimbledon semifinals in 2025—a run that fueled fresh “Novak Djokovic” searches among US tennis fans.

    Rivals Emerge: Can Djokovic Hold Off the Next Generation?

    Many analysts peg Jannik Sinner (31-4 season, four titles) and Carlos Alcaraz (54 wins, six titles) as threats to Novak Djokovic’s US Open quest. Djokovic’s draw, however, could favor him: he’s dominated likely opponent Taylor Fritz, holding a 10-0 record in head-to-head matches.

    Veteran US tennis experts hold faith. “If anyone can use experience and tactical savvy to edge out the new wave, it’s Novak Djokovic,” ESPN’s Patrick McEnroe said.

    Off-Court Focus: Family, Wellness, and New Challenges

    Djokovic’s personal life now plays a greater role in his schedule. By taking time off for family and wellness, he mirrors choices by top US athletes in basketball and football. Djokovic notes that recovery “makes the difference” as he navigates a sport dominated by younger, faster challengers.

    This strategy isn’t risk-free. Critics note Djokovic missed recent hard-court reps, making each match a challenge for rhythm and confidence.
